Method
Combine rice, 5 cups milk, sugar, salt, and cinnamon stick in a heavy saucepan.
Bring to a gentle simmer and cook uncovered, stirring frequently, until the rice is tender and the mixture is creamy, 35–45 minutes.
Remove the cinnamon stick. Stir in vanilla, raisins if using, and enough remaining milk for a loose consistency.
Serve warm or cool rapidly and refrigerate. Sprinkle with ground cinnamon.
Notes
The pudding thickens substantially when chilled; reserve milk to loosen before service.
